Offshore wind projects serving New England are beginning to support the grid during both winter cold snaps and summer heat, reducing reliance on oil and natural gas during periods of high demand. Vineyard Wind, Revolution Wind, and South Fork Wind are supplying power or moving toward full operation, while analyses indicate that a larger offshore fleet could improve reliability and reduce exposure to volatile fuel costs. Progress remains uneven, as Vineyard Wind operates below expected capacity, the NECEC transmission line has experienced outages, and federal, legal, and technical delays are slowing additional clean-power deployment.

Summary

  • Offshore wind contributed during the July 2026 heat wave, when New England used less oil-fired generation than during a comparable 2025 heat event.
  • Vineyard Wind and Revolution Wind are supplying electricity as they complete commissioning, while South Fork Wind has delivered power consistently to Long Island.
  • Winter-focused analyses find that additional offshore wind could substantially lower modeled demand-driven outage risk and reduce reliance on imported liquefied natural gas.
  • Vineyard Wind has operated below expected capacity while in litigation with GE Vernova.
  • The NECEC transmission line delivered no power to New England for roughly two weeks because of technical problems and repairs.
  • Clean-power disruptions can increase reliance on natural gas and oil, complicating emissions goals even though grid officials report no immediate reliability emergency.
  • Massachusetts expects long-term Vineyard Wind contracts to lower customer electricity costs, though some savings figures come from project or advocacy-group estimates.
